Job description

The Bureau Finance Officer reports to the Manager, Regional Finance & Operations (RFO) as well as maintains a dotted line to the head of the bureau organization (Bureau Chief, Head of Office, or Managing Editor). This position is responsible for the financial administration and office management of the bureau. As such the incumbent ensures the best possible financial and operational support to the bureau leadership and the bureau staff in their efforts to carry out the RFE/RL mission. The Bureau Finance Officer is responsible for the efficient and reliable financial management of the office, for helping to ensure compliance with local legislation and RFE/RL policies and procedures, and for reporting and responding to requests from other departments as well as from statutory bodies.

Radio Free Europe/Radio Liberty (RFE/RL) is an international news organization headquartered in Prague, Czech Republic and Washington, D.C., with 21 bureaus throughout Russia, Central Asia, Afghanistan, and Central and Eastern Europe. Reporting in 27 languages across 23 countries, RFE/RL is one of the most comprehensive news operations in the world, providing responsibly reported, fact-based news in countries where media freedoms are under threat or banned outright. From Iran and Pakistan to Hungary, Ukraine, and Azerbaijan, RFE/RL journalists give audiences what they can't always get from their own local media: uncensored information and open debate. Reporting via digital, TV, and radio platforms, RFE/RL has a measured weekly reach of 38.1 million people. A private nonprofit, RFE/RL is funded by the U.S. Congress through the U.S. Agency for Global Media. RFE/RL's editorial independence is protected by U.S. law.
